Birthplace : NottinghamBorn : 21-01-1984Position : Defender
Wes Morgan came to Aggborough on loan from his parent club, Nottingham Forest, in February 2003 and straight away won the faithful over with his solid displays in defence.

He scored one goal for us, in his final game at Cambridge, but was then recalled by the Forest manager, Paul Hart.

Once returned to the City Ground Wes made sure he became one of the first names on the team sheet and stayed in the first team at Forest for a further nine years finally leaving in January 2012 to join Leicester City for a fee thought to be around £1,000,000.

Two years later he helped City win promotion to the Premier League and within another two years to the title.

All Harriers fans are proud that Wes was the first ever ‘former’ Harrier to lead his side to the ultimate accolade. A Premier League winners medal with the Premier League champions and then in 2021 a FA Cup Winners medal too.

On that high note Wes finally hung up his boots on an illustrious career.
